Building consistent sleep routines for all family members
Building consistent sleep routines for all family members helps promote overall health and supports weight loss efforts for remote workers. A regular sleep schedule reduces stress, improves mood, and boosts energy—crucial factors for maintaining healthy routines.
Establishing a consistent bedtime and wake-up time for each family member creates a stable environment that encourages better sleep quality. This consistency helps everyone’s body clock stay regulated, making it easier to fall asleep and wake refreshed.
Creating a calming pre-sleep routine, such as reading or gentle stretching, signals to the body that it’s time to wind down. Limiting screen time before bed also supports better sleep, especially since technology can interfere with melatonin production.
Open communication and shared goals foster accountability and motivate the entire family to stick with sleep routines. When everyone values quality sleep, it reinforces healthy habits that support weight loss and overall wellness in a positive, supportive environment.

Overcoming common barriers to family involvement in healthy routines
Common barriers to involving the family in healthy routines often include busy schedules, limited motivation, and lack of knowledge. Recognizing these challenges allows for practical solutions that foster a more supportive environment.
Time constraints can make it difficult for everyone to participate in shared activities. Setting realistic goals and scheduling routines during manageable times helps overcome this barrier and encourages consistent involvement.
Motivation may wane if routines feel monotonous or overwhelming. Making activities fun and varied, such as family challenges or themed workouts, keeps enthusiasm high and promotes ongoing engagement in healthy habits.
Lack of knowledge about nutrition and exercise can hinder participation. Providing simple educational resources and involving the family in learning together creates a sense of empowerment and shared purpose.
Addressing these common barriers with optimism and clear strategies makes involving the family in healthy routines more achievable, especially for remote workers juggling multiple responsibilities.

Creating virtual fitness challenges or competitions
Creating virtual fitness challenges or competitions can be a fantastic way to involve the entire family in healthy routines, especially for remote workers. This approach fosters motivation, accountability, and fun through friendly competition. Here are some effective ways to implement it:
- Set clear, achievable goals like steps taken or minutes exercised per day.
- Use family-friendly fitness apps or online platforms to track progress seamlessly.
- Create themed challenges, such as a step-count race or a weekly yoga streak.
- Encourage participation by offering small rewards or recognition for milestones.
By engaging everyone in these virtual challenges, families can build healthy habits together while enjoying the process. This method promotes consistency and enthusiasm, making healthy routines an enjoyable part of daily life. It also nurtures a supportive environment that inspires each member to stay committed to their health goals.
